<p>Location: 6002 Parks & Recreation/Recreation</p> <p>Pay Grade: A00</p> <p>FLSA Status: Non-exempt</p> <p>The Swimming Pool Cashier & Concessions position are customer facing jobs that include preparing, cooking, and serving both food and beverage items; calculating and collecting payments in cash, credit, and check forms using a Point of Sale system, including operating a cash drawer, and returning accurate change; providing customer service in-person and over the phone, including, but not limited to, checking patron heights and answering patron questions; and assisting in maintaining cleanliness of all aquatic facilities.</p> <ul> <li>This position performs duties deemed to be "safety-sensitive" and is therefore subjected to random drug testing under the City's policies. * </li><li>Provides excellent guest services to all patrons, in person and via phone. </li><li>Utilizes a computer-based Point of Sale for pool admissions and concession sales. </li><li>Accepts payments including cash, debit and credit cards; includes making change for cash payments. </li><li>Prepares food such as hot dogs, packaged foods, ice cream dishes, and fountain drinks. </li><li>Cleans all work area surfaces and equipment. </li><li>Stocks and restock items as necessary. </li><li>Directs and instructing patrons within assigned areas. </li><li>Provides a safe environment for all participants using pool slides, and for participants in and around the pool. </li><li>Monitors access to water slide and only permit individuals who meet the height requirements to ride the slide. </li><li>Scans the catch pool to ensure swimmers are a safe distance from the slide exit. </li><li>Enforces all aquatic facility policies, rules, and regulations. </li><li>Performs other duties as assigned. </li></ul> <p>Candidates must be at least 16 years of age. Ability to read, write and perform mathematical calculations at a high school level. Possession of or ability to obtain a current Food Handler Permit issued by the Tulsa County Health Department.</p> <p>The work is typically performed while sitting, standing, or stooping. The employee will occasionally lift, pull, push, or move items up to 25 pounds in weight.</p>
